Unveiling the Key Technological Advances and Consumer Trends Reshaping the Electric HandBike Ecosystem in the Coming Decade
The electric handbike ecosystem is rapidly transforming under the influence of battery chemistry breakthroughs, connected device capabilities, and evolving consumer attitudes. Recent improvements in lithium-ion cell density and affordability have extended operational range, reduced recharging cycles, and enabled sleeker frame designs. Meanwhile, alternative chemistries such as nickel-metal hydride are being revisited for niche applications where cost sensitivity outweighs weight considerations. These technological shifts are complemented by the integration of IoT sensors that provide predictive maintenance alerts and adaptive power delivery, creating a seamless user experience that bridges medical, recreational, and sporting domains.
Consumer preferences are also shifting toward holistic lifestyle solutions rather than isolated mobility aids. Enthusiasts are seeking devices capable of tackling rugged mountain trails, urban commutes, and community sporting events with equal ease. This has led to cross-industry collaborations involving outdoor gear specialists, healthcare providers, and digital health platforms to co-create products that deliver performance, comfort, and data-driven coaching. As a result, market entrants and incumbents alike are prioritizing modular designs that can be reconfigured for different applications, from high-torque mountain climbs to steady city rides. In turn, this reorientation toward versatility is reshaping product roadmaps and forging new pathways for revenue generation.
Assessing the Cumulative Consequences of 2025 United States Tariffs on Electric HandBike Supply Chains and Market Viability
The introduction of new United States tariffs on select imported components and finished electric handbikes in 2025 has reverberated throughout supply chains and pricing structures. While the primary aim of these measures is to incentivize domestic manufacturing and protect emerging local capacity, the immediate effect has been a rise in landed costs for many original equipment manufacturers. Suppliers reliant on overseas battery modules or specialized drive systems have had to renegotiate contracts, absorb part of the increased duty, or pass additional costs onto distributors and end users.
In response, several stakeholders have pursued dual strategies involving nearshoring and tariff engineering. Manufacturers are relocating assembly operations closer to key consumer markets to minimize transoceanic shipping expenses and duty liabilities. Simultaneously, product architectures are being reexamined to identify tariff-exempt subassemblies and alternative sourcing regions. While these adaptation efforts require upfront capital investment, they are accelerating the shift toward more resilient and geographically diversified supply networks. In the medium term, economies of scale achieved through regional production hubs are expected to offset initial cost pressures, enabling competitive pricing and stable delivery timelines despite the tariff landscape.
Deriving Strategic Market Insights Through a Multi-Dimensional Segmentation Lens That Drives Targeted Development and Outreach
A nuanced understanding of market segmentation reveals targeted opportunities for growth and specialization in the electric handbike industry. Examining application categories such as medical rehabilitation, mountaineering, recreational cycling, competitive sports, and utility use uncovers distinct user needs and procurement drivers. For instance, medical facilities prioritize reliability and regulatory compliance, whereas recreational enthusiasts focus on battery range and terrain adaptability. Similarly, front hub drive, mid drive, and rear hub drive bike types each offer unique performance and maintenance profiles that correspond to specific user goals, whether that entails precise torque control on steep inclines or ease of wheel replacement in urban environments.
The role of distribution channels further shapes market dynamics, as independent dealers build personalized service relationships, mass merchandise outlets drive volume adoption through promotional events, online retailers offer rapid delivery and customization portals, and specialty retailers curate premium experiences. Battery type segmentation highlights the continued dominance of lithium-ion systems for their energy density, while lead-acid remains relevant in low-cost tiers and nickel-metal hydride finds use in niche industrial deployments. Preferences for motor power between 250 watts and 500 watts reflect a balance between regulatory compliance and performance, whereas above 500-watt options cater to extreme sports applications and steep terrain challenges. Finally, price range segmentation into high, mid, and low tiers underscores the importance of tailoring value propositions from premium feature sets to cost-competitive entry models. This multi-dimensional lens enables stakeholders to align product development, marketing strategies, and distribution partnerships with finely defined customer segments.
Navigating Regional Growth Patterns and Consumer Behavior Dynamics Across Key Global Markets to Inform Regional Strategies
Regional analysis illustrates that geographic context significantly influences demand patterns, regulatory landscapes, and go-to-market strategies in the electric handbike sector. In the Americas, strong healthcare infrastructure, supportive public policies, and a large outdoor recreation community drive robust uptake across both medical and sports applications. Urban centers with bike-friendly initiatives are creating micro-markets for last-mile mobility solutions, while rehabilitation centers continue to invest in advanced assistive devices for patient recovery.
Across Europe, the Middle East, and Africa, diverse sub-regions present varied trajectories. Western Europe’s rigorous safety standards and growing sports tourism ecosystem have stimulated product enhancements in durability and performance telemetry. Meanwhile, emerging markets in the Middle East demonstrate a preference for premium, luxury-oriented models tailored to niche adventure tourism. In Africa, infrastructure limitations have spurred interest in rugged drive systems and battery solutions that can withstand high temperatures and limited charging networks. Transitioning further east, Asia-Pacific markets showcase a blend of manufacturing leadership and rapidly expanding domestic demand. Countries such as China and Japan are investing heavily in R&D capabilities, driving cost efficiencies and technological differentiation. Simultaneously, Australia’s well-developed outdoor sports culture and India’s expanding healthcare sector are unlocking new paths for adoption, each shaped by unique regulatory and consumer characteristics.
